In local SEO almost all traffic arrives from mobile, and that's where performance weighs most. However well optimised your Google Business Profile is, if the site keeps people waiting after they tap the link, they go back and open a competitor's instead. Core Web Vitals are a confirmed ranking factor — and they are also the first impression your customer gets.

Always after a significant change — a redesign, a new plugin, a migration — because those are the moments when performance tends to break without anyone noticing. Beyond that, a monthly check is enough to catch gradual degradation in time. Every audit is stored in the history, so you can compare against previous ones and prove the improvement.
Core Web Vitals are a ranking factor confirmed by Google, and they weigh more on mobile, which is exactly where most local searches happen. A flawless Google Business Profile still loses customers if the site is slow to load when they tap through: the user goes back and leaves for a competitor.
